Fulani Herdsmen Arrested In Benue For For Violating Open Grazing Law

The issue of clash between Fulani herdsmen and farmers in Benue and the passing of open grazing law by the Bebue State Government is no longer news.




Following series of meetings between the Otukpo Local government Chairman, Hon. George Alli and the Fulani community in Otukpo over the law prohibiting open grazing as enacted into law and subsequent implementation from November 2017, some non challant Fulani herdsmen were seen openly grazing their cattle in Otukpo.


The Otukpo Council Chairman, personally witnessed the gross violation of the Anti-Open Grazing Law, immediately directed the arrest of the culprits, and directed immediate investigation into the matter.
